CRUNCHY PUMPKIN-PEANUT BUTTER DOG COOKIES<p>
Prep time: 20 minutes<br>
Bake time: 45 minutes<p>
Preheat oven to 350 degrees<p>
1 cups whole wheat flour<br>
1/2 cup wheat germ<br>
1 cup cornmeal<br>
1/2 cup peanut butter<br>
1/2 cup canned pumpkin (plain, no spices)<br>
1 cup hot water<p>
Combine dry ingredients in medium bowl. Add peanut butter, pumpkin and water and mix together until it forms a doughy ball. <p>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EiRLWkYTpgBLAzoxSe2WYVj6mfRIDlFLNED7kI-1yjxeoudmivrizg1niJCICxkEMf0plxXE2eHP_qboPjxu3Z8PndhhZnj_wkzDgQeObfBoEU3HL0J2Tusf9kfU27TOBIIpcx8pIWeN7w/s1600/1019-dough.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left:1em; margin-right:1em"><img border="0" height="240" width="320"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EiRLWkYTpgBLAzoxSe2WYVj6mfRIDlFLNED7kI-1yjxeoudmivrizg1niJCICxkEMf0plxXE2eHP_qboPjxu3Z8PndhhZnj_wkzDgQeObfBoEU3HL0J2Tusf9kfU27TOBIIpcx8pIWeN7w/s320/1019-dough.jpg" /></a></div>
<center>A doughy ball</center><p>
Turn out dough on well-floured surface and knead about 10 times, adding extra flour if necessary. Roll out about 1/4 inch thick and cut with your choice of cookie cutter. (Or roll the dough into 1-inch balls, and flatten with a fork.)<p>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Egvl64jgUqhh2ekzbtgo4zI5cG6oFjAUuLaNL_j5X6A8vnIGJL-cKqgh5-tRpaYd-bpWPOBHfcJluJXZ14z9GBVCrcjl36RcFE3x1TXAMwx22Rdop6lt-2-9lHs11F0rgF_Ma2uHpViYB8/s1600/1019-cut-pan.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left:1em; margin-right:1em"><img border="0" height="154" width="400"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Egvl64jgUqhh2ekzbtgo4zI5cG6oFjAUuLaNL_j5X6A8vnIGJL-cKqgh5-tRpaYd-bpWPOBHfcJluJXZ14z9GBVCrcjl36RcFE3x1TXAMwx22Rdop6lt-2-9lHs11F0rgF_Ma2uHpViYB8/s400/1019-cut-pan.jpg" /></a></div>
<p>
Place with sides touching on lightly greased cookie sheet, and bake for 40 minutes at 350 degrees.<p>
Cool as much the dogs will let you! For a super crunchy cookie, cool the cookies in the turned-off oven, with the door slightly open.<p>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jyFdGaj1ciuK7ysR30GwGgqKiG1fjgfq5t_nfvIbBKPOPMpDGG0BaB3zHKQwWsaZcOaNLOLgph4mOEuAPHJ89G3BjBE0WY9GxoD2N80ZATx3y657WQhuunyfzLxEZdvkSWFhqsOrstpS4/s1600/1019-coolmom.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left:1em; margin-right:1em"><img border="0" height="203" width="320"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jyFdGaj1ciuK7ysR30GwGgqKiG1fjgfq5t_nfvIbBKPOPMpDGG0BaB3zHKQwWsaZcOaNLOLgph4mOEuAPHJ89G3BjBE0WY9GxoD2N80ZATx3y657WQhuunyfzLxEZdvkSWFhqsOrstpS4/s320/1019-coolmom.jpg" /></a></div>
<center>MOM! They're cool enough!</center><p>
I used a 1-3/4 shot glass as a cutter and got 90 (7-1/2 dozen) cookies. Recipe yield will depend on size of the cutter and thickness of dough. Recipe can easily be halved or doubled.<p>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EhuSyNBzeHuBXH7QwubYSgsCvPlU6Fu1MxIr4R6Jf9aQTpqpmjzLYC8cohw4XdDQtwApGVZCjXlY7Y2L6eZKuoDGTtIMuWsxUInaMkUIfd9bsCZgJBiaXFFAyalgwGz0p7P5g15qTaMUgE/s1600/1019-bag.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left:1em; margin-right:1em"><img border="0" height="261" width="320"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EhuSyNBzeHuBXH7QwubYSgsCvPlU6Fu1MxIr4R6Jf9aQTpqpmjzLYC8cohw4XdDQtwApGVZCjXlY7Y2L6eZKuoDGTtIMuWsxUInaMkUIfd9bsCZgJBiaXFFAyalgwGz0p7P5g15qTaMUgE/s320/1019-bag.jpg" /></a></div>
<center>Big bag o' cookies!</center><p>
Store in an airtight container. Cookies will keep for about 2 weeks, but probably won't be around that long! <p>

Little Meat Hand Pies<p>
Prep time: 30 minutes<br>
Cook time: 20 minutes<p>
Preheat oven to 375 degrees<p>
1/2 lb. ground beef<br>
12 oz. jar beef gravy<br>
12 oz. bag mixed vegetables<br>
Bake and serve crescent roll dough (will need 4 cans for entire recipe yield)<p>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EidEPb8x0q2ysw3oamTDOT1LpmWqg-BiEfkF670vYK7kzF9dtbPMsrmr8PUCW5iZDQVDbaQ7n9K2NurcIAjQ8ueh4OtmxGw5yNJh5qWocmO8PYcg7iT4Oi1d6BcesN0Im2UW2DRVmWDIrU/s1600/meat+pie+need+1017.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left:1em; margin-right:1em"><img border="0" height="240" width="320"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EidEPb8x0q2ysw3oamTDOT1LpmWqg-BiEfkF670vYK7kzF9dtbPMsrmr8PUCW5iZDQVDbaQ7n9K2NurcIAjQ8ueh4OtmxGw5yNJh5qWocmO8PYcg7iT4Oi1d6BcesN0Im2UW2DRVmWDIrU/s320/meat+pie+need+1017.jpg" /></a></div>
<p>
Cut a slit in the veggie bag and microwave on high for 4 minutes, drain excess water.<p>
Meanwhile, brown ground beef, breaking it up into small pieces.<p>
Combine ground beef, veggies, and about 1/2 the gravy (3/4 cup) in medium size bowl. (You want everything to be coated in gravy, but not too wet a mixture.) Season to taste with onion powder, garlic powder, basil, salt and pepper. (Sorry, I hardly ever measure spices, I just give it a few shakes of each and taste test.)<p>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jXp0kVrak73GrTW1T1SkGx0RO_2P1RcO6ATMC-8L4ZOaDyuzmkz31lna6W2QK91YorH9_TYkNnrBBTf-fTzBeGgx6IyUSKD5M1bx_C-sFx0MoUP7dn4pqklJtUdaH68r9Qu4tOmPdKkdc/s1600/meat+pie+mix+1017.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left:1em; margin-right:1em"><img border="0" height="240" width="320"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jXp0kVrak73GrTW1T1SkGx0RO_2P1RcO6ATMC-8L4ZOaDyuzmkz31lna6W2QK91YorH9_TYkNnrBBTf-fTzBeGgx6IyUSKD5M1bx_C-sFx0MoUP7dn4pqklJtUdaH68r9Qu4tOmPdKkdc/s320/meat+pie+mix+1017.jpg" /></a></div>
<p>
Seperate crescent rolls - you'll use 2 triangles for each pie. Place a big heaping tablespoon of filling on one triangle. Cover with a 2nd triangle. Pinch around edges to seal. (I tear off the long, unfilled "tails" of the dough and use the pieces to help cover and seal the longest side.) Use a spatula to transfer pies to an ungreased cookie sheet.<p>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EhdNKyZ5BtFi_zGR9YGovkDcyF1Dhpe42w01ZR6_-QeL0b1LvaX9qZ3_Zx3DJyODKOu0sZh5EwgvKK2T1dPVsuYz1pm2N1qGXh-3o9GY7GIibsbwAUDhLkVhjlnGg5aqpA7_SEcxLbMkgk/s1600/meat+pie+prep+1017.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left:1em; margin-right:1em"><img border="0" height="106" width="400"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EhdNKyZ5BtFi_zGR9YGovkDcyF1Dhpe42w01ZR6_-QeL0b1LvaX9qZ3_Zx3DJyODKOu0sZh5EwgvKK2T1dPVsuYz1pm2N1qGXh-3o9GY7GIibsbwAUDhLkVhjlnGg5aqpA7_SEcxLbMkgk/s400/meat+pie+prep+1017.jpg" /></a></div>
<p>
Bake at 375 degrees for 15-20 minutes or until golden brown on top.<p>
Cool to touch and eat - no fork required!<p>
Recipe will yield 16 pies - 2 to 4 pies per serving, depending on your appetite. (If you don't need to make all 16 at once, leftover filling can be refrigerated - and is also great served over rice with remaining gravy!) <p>
Variations: Use shredded chicken and chopped broccoli with chicken gravy, or diced ham and chopped spinach with alfredo sauce!<p>

This is the quickest, easiest cat toy you'll ever find - and you probably have everything you need to make it right on hand! <p>
What you'll need:<p>
1 lonely-only sock (you know, the one the dryer ate the mate to)<br>
1 plastic grocery bag<br>
1 tablespoon catnip (optional - some cats just aren't into it)<p>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EgUCk5H23TOQu-bCBeMobo2Tx9vRrjh1J4AuSO_iX-jw6j8cO_Gs5_35-5L4jeH36IuhFGbOKeKqjxuKwmjNzXMEm5wh1ArdgRxd8ZpKqG_Z_oqLtdOQbgQ_adFvYXUpBrz42IdJyqSl80/s1600/kitty1-1016.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left:1em; margin-right:1em"><img border="0" height="295" width="320"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EgUCk5H23TOQu-bCBeMobo2Tx9vRrjh1J4AuSO_iX-jw6j8cO_Gs5_35-5L4jeH36IuhFGbOKeKqjxuKwmjNzXMEm5wh1ArdgRxd8ZpKqG_Z_oqLtdOQbgQ_adFvYXUpBrz42IdJyqSl80/s320/kitty1-1016.jpg" /></a></div>
<center>(Yes, that IS catnip, lol)</center><p>
Cut a piece out of the plastic bag (about 1/4 to 1/2 the bag, depending on how big you want the toy to be) and stuff it into the toe of the sock. This gives it that nice "crinkly" sound that cats love. Add the catnip (if using) and shake it up a little to spread the catnip throughout.<p>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Egcr9dAS6yRxj-pYeFastcqomCtXxBcvvmWSOFQT-eV3mEAwij2NKsh_T4ZeygBdZs1EFMohVndTiS4aAXrvuUzURBWNLPp9Krr8WydVHi3sdYY50jh4Qx9gRLfMsUinMJOW7nfn6ukDIA/s1600/kitty2-1016.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left:1em; margin-right:1em"><img border="0" height="320" width="296"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Egcr9dAS6yRxj-pYeFastcqomCtXxBcvvmWSOFQT-eV3mEAwij2NKsh_T4ZeygBdZs1EFMohVndTiS4aAXrvuUzURBWNLPp9Krr8WydVHi3sdYY50jh4Qx9gRLfMsUinMJOW7nfn6ukDIA/s320/kitty2-1016.jpg" /></a></div>
<center>Stuffed Sock</center><p>
Tie a tight knot in the sock, as close to the "ball" as possible.<p>
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EiS3UD_-2HBezX0ET9eFOfGzfgOjmab1jFDNpMcpRpviBRBRKC6HGdIfeBeXlQTpu4gm9u1oS_KWre1maYVMztl9QCkxNO0ZOCkho2gc7HnGa5VWVUy94If-WEsPJ5qtDtMaWyPFXbhkRE/s1600/kitty3-1016.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left:1em; margin-right:1em"><img border="0" height="320" width="249"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EiS3UD_-2HBezX0ET9eFOfGzfgOjmab1jFDNpMcpRpviBRBRKC6HGdIfeBeXlQTpu4gm9u1oS_KWre1maYVMztl9QCkxNO0ZOCkho2gc7HnGa5VWVUy94If-WEsPJ5qtDtMaWyPFXbhkRE/s320/kitty3-1016.jpg" /></a></div>
<center>Done!</center><p>
At this point, you have several options - you can leave the top of the sock attached as a "handle" so you can dangle it for your kitty; you can cut the top off close to the knot so your cat can play with it alone; or you can cut the top off and tie (tightly) a piece of string, yarn, or elastic around the base of the knot at the top of the ball to hang it from a doorknob. Any way you do it, your cat will love it - and you! <p>
(Note - the pics are not exactly actual size, the toy is about 1-1/2 inches across and 2-1/2 inches long, including the knot, using 1/4 of the bag.)<p>
